Output 907e2a3416ef152f13fcfa7051e928bd5b996dba3f4f470ba6e1092d26392224:13

value
10962099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d4608511a2c08e3501af6153cd147b53dc205e OP_EQUAL
address
3LdvDU4fDJvk6yoTqcmAPNyBkECptBssy9
transaction
907e2a3416ef152f13fcfa7051e928bd5b996dba3f4f470ba6e1092d26392224
spent
true